""" | ||
Function creating each possible variant with WT information | ||
Commands: | ||
======= | ||
Example: | ||
======= | ||
python FillVariants.py prism_uniprot_XXX_uniprot_id.txt | ||
""" | ||
|
||
# Standard library imports | ||
from argparse import ArgumentParser | ||
from datetime import datetime | ||
import os | ||
|
||
# Third party imports | ||
import pandas as pd | ||
|
||
# Local application imports | ||
from PrismData import PrismParser, VariantData | ||
|
||
|
||
def parse_args(): | ||
""" | ||
Argument parser function | ||
""" | ||
|
||
parser = ArgumentParser( description="" ) | ||
|
||
# Initiating/setup command line arguments | ||
parser.add_argument( 'file', | ||
type=str, | ||
help="Prism data file to process" | ||
) | ||
parser.add_argument('--output_dir', '-o', | ||
type=str, | ||
default='', | ||
help="Directory where files will be written. If not specified, the input directory will be used." | ||
) | ||
parser.add_argument('--incl_del', '-i', | ||
default=False, | ||
type=lambda s: s.lower() in ['true', 't', 'yes', '1'], | ||
help="generates values for ~ and * too. Default False" | ||
) | ||
|
||
args = parser.parse_args() | ||
|
||
# Generate and check saved outputs | ||
if args.output_dir!='': | ||
if not os.path.isdir(args.output_dir): | ||
os.makedirs(args.output_dir) | ||
else: | ||
args.output_dir = os.path.dirname(os.path.abspath(args.file)) | ||
if args.incl_del != False: | ||
args.incl_del = True | ||
return args | ||
|
||
|
||
def copy_wt_variants(dataframe, incl_del=False): | ||
#copy wt columns to all variants | ||
|
||
if 'aa_var' in dataframe.columns: | ||
dataframe = dataframe.drop(columns=['aa_var']) | ||
final_df = dataframe.copy() | ||
final_df['variant'] = final_df['variant'].str.replace(r'=', 'A') | ||
final_df['aa_var'] = ['A']*len(dataframe['variant']) | ||
if incl_del: | ||
resi_list = ['C','D','E', 'F','G','H', 'I','K','L','M','N','P','Q','R','S','T','V','W','Y', '~', '*'] | ||
else: | ||
resi_list = ['C','D','E', 'F','G','H', 'I','K','L','M','N','P','Q','R','S','T','V','W','Y'] | ||
for variant in resi_list: | ||
df = dataframe.copy() | ||
df['variant'] = df['variant'].str.replace('=', variant) | ||
df['aa_var'] = [variant]*len(dataframe['variant']) | ||
final_df = pd.concat([final_df, df], axis=0, ignore_index=True) | ||
final_df['aa_var'] = final_df['variant'].apply(lambda x: x[-1]) | ||
final_df['aa_ref'] = final_df['variant'].apply(lambda x: x[0]) | ||
final_df['res'] = final_df['variant'].apply(lambda x: int(x[1:-1])) | ||
mask = final_df['aa_ref']==final_df['aa_var'] | ||
final_df.loc[mask, 'aa_var'] = '=' | ||
final_df['variant'] = final_df['aa_ref'] + final_df['res'].astype(str) + final_df['aa_var'] | ||
final_df = final_df.sort_values(by=['res','aa_var']) | ||
for elem in ['n_mut', 'aa_ref', 'resi', 'aa_var', 'res']: | ||
if elem in final_df.columns: | ||
final_df = final_df.drop(columns=elem) | ||
final_df = final_df.drop_duplicates().reset_index(drop=True) | ||
return(final_df) | ||
